    Re: How often do BP's shed?

    Pay no attention to trcmustang...

    Shedding happens more frequently when younger and less frequently when older given that shedding has to do with growing out of their skin.

    When mine were really young, they would shed every few weeks. Now that they are older, they shed less frequently.

    Bottom line: the snake knows when it needs to shed and will let you know by the changing of the eye color and the dull and wrinkly appearance

    Re: How often do BP's shed?

    It depends on the age of the snake. Young snakes shed more often than older snakes b/c they are growing faster. It also depends on the snake itself. Some babies grow faster than others. I wanna say that baby balls shed about once a month, but like I said, that is just a very vague estimate...

    Re: How often do BP's shed?

    Just make sure your humidity is high enough so that it will all come off. You want it to be up around 60% or so. ^_^
